About Lufthansa Group Business Services Sp. z o.o.

Lufthansa Group Business Services GmbH (LGBS) is a 100 per cent Lufthansa subsidiary. We offer shared services worldwide for the entire company in the areas of Finance, Business Intelligence & Transformation, Human Resources, Procurement and IT, which we provide or manage ourselves. It’s our goal to harmonize and standardize processes and to continuously make them more efficient and effective. We see ourselves as pioneers in digitization, as well as in the use and distribution of the latest technologies, for example in business process automation.As an internationally operating company, LGBS is represented at locations in Frankfurt, Hamburg, Krakow, Manila and Mexico City and manages BPO providers in Germany and abroad. With the global network of foreign representatives of the Lufthansa Groups field organization, we are also locally anchored and active worldwide.
